Invitation for PhD Student Applications in ‘Applied Childhood Studies’
Research Centre for Children, Families and Communities (Canterbury Christ Church University, Canterbury, Kent, UK)
The Research Centre for Children, Families and Communities (RCfCFC) welcomes applicants for MPhil/PhD studies (to begin study in for October 2014).
Established in 2009, RCfCFC is specialist research centre based within Canterbury Christ Church University. RCfCFC draws together academics from education, health and social care and the social sciences in order to undertake high quality research which is underpinned by a commitment to the participation and voice of children and young people.
We are specifically looking for applications from candidates with an interest in:
• Impact of austerity measures on child poverty
• Social divisions and discrimination
• Family functioning and wellbeing
• Social exclusion and inclusion
• Politics of early childhood
Full-time PhD scholarships (a stipend of £11,700 pa and free tuition for three years) are available for successful applicants.
The application deadline is Wednesday 30th April 2014.
Registration for successful applicants will be 1st October 2014.
